This unlikely trio astounded the audience at the 2007 Grammys. Corinne Bailey Rae, John Legend, and John Mayer took the stage together and each artist sang one of their songs while being accompanied by the other two. Rae started with "Like A Star" followed by a gorgeous "Coming Home" by John Legend. Rae harmonizing on the chorus with Legend was chill-inducing and brought me to tears. The medley ended with "Gravity" by John Mayer, who performed a wicked guitar solo before picking up the Grammy for best male pop vocal album.
